Each country is permitted to field up to three teams in the 2007 competition. The host city may also provide a team in addition to the country teams. The IYFCC organizing committee in each country develops the criteria for qualifying teams in that country. The team representing the host city will be selected by invitation of the IYFCC organizing committee. The United States organizing committee has chosen three qualifying events for the 2007 International Fuel Cells Competition. The top three winning teams from each competition will be eligible to apply for participation in the 2007 IYFCC. The application will include personal interviews and a written test. Students must be between the ages of 15-18 on October 10, 2007 to be eligible. One team from each qualifying event may be chosen to represent the United States in the 2007 competition in San Antonio, Texas. Sponsorship of the United States teams will be the responsibility of the qualifying event coordinators. Currently, the qualifying events are: Pennsylvania State University High School Car Competition Florida Solar Energy Center High School Car Competition Ecotality - Arizona High School Car Competition |
